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ова




НазваниеРоссийской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ова
страница10/11
Дата03.02.2016
Размер9,94 Kb.
ТипУчебное пособие
1   2   3   4   5   6   7   8   9   10   11

Контрольные вопросы


  1. Особенности выполнение операции деления чисел с фиксированной запятой, представленных в прямом коде.

  2. Способы деления чисел с фиксированной запятой.

  3. Состав и назначение основных регистров АЛУ для выполнения операции деления чисел с фиксированной запятой, представленных в прямом коде.

Содержание отчета


  1. Формулировка задания.

  2. Структурная схема АЛУ для выполнения операции умножения чисел с фиксированной запятой, представленных в прямом коде.

  3. Блок-схема выполнения операции умножения чисел с фиксированной запятой, представленных в прямом коде.

  4. Программа на языке MCL, моделирующая выполнение операции умножения чисел с фиксированной запятой, представленных в прямом код.

  5. Результаты выполнения программы.

Варианты заданий


Промоделировать работу АЛУ в системе MCL при выполнении операции деления в соответствие с номером варианта. Номера вариантов даны в Таблице 3.1.

При написании программы рекомендуется использовать следующие обозначения:

TS – знак операции деления;

SCH - счетчик циклов;

R1 – регистр делителя;

R2, RB – регистр делимого;

R3, SM – регистры АЛУ для организации сдвига;

RC – регистр суммы АЛУ;

RA – регистр для формирования дополнительного и прямого кода делителя;

INP1,INP2 – входные регистры.

Разрядность регистров АЛУ принимается 8 бит. Число циклов деления равно разрядности операндов, т.е. восьми. При выполнении лабораторной работы для наглядности, необходимо печатать содержимое всех регистров АЛУ на каждом такте деления. Содержимое регистров должно быть представлено в двоичной форме, исходные значения операндов и результаты – в десятичной системе счисления.

Таблица 3.1. Варианты заданий для моделирования операции деления


Номер варианта

Делимое

Делитель

1

20

-2322

1980

-1152

4

9

-36

-96

2

18

-1701

345

-1342

3

6

-15

-23

3

12

-1890

1872

-833

4

7

-36

-17

4

14

-999

720

-455

2

3

-45

-13

5

24

-1176

935

-2625

4

4

-11

-75

6

24

-2210

1368

-1012

8

8

-19

-23

7

32

-1768

2120

-1212

4

6

-40

-101

8

20

-2814

1701

-1363

5

10

-21

-29

9

18

-1089

3000

-720

6

4

-40

-24

10

20

-1008

3920

-1632

2

3

-49

-17

11

10

-1582

1290

-2997

5

6

-15

-81

12

12

-728

1288

-1593

2

2

-23

-27

13

15

-1432

980

-152

5

5

-36

-96

14

14

-1801

345

-1342

7

6

-15

-23

15

18

-1890

1872

-833

9

7

-36

-17

16

18

-1999

720

-455

2

7

-45

-13

17

36

-1200

935

-2625

9

4

-11

-75

18

21

-2565

1368

-1012

7

10

-19

-23

19

18

-1878

2120

-1212

9

7

-40

-101

20

9

-2345

1701

-1363

3

9

-21

-29

21

21

-1190

3000

-720

3

45

-40

-24

22

22

-1248

3920

-1632

11

4

-49

-17

23

22

-1792

1290

-2997

2

7

-15

-81

24

24

-538

1288

-1593

3

2

-23

-27















Формирование знака результата, обнуление знаков делимого и делителя





Сдвиг делимого на 1 разряд влево



Пробное вычитание делителя


Деление

невозможно

“0”

Деление

возможно

<0”








Запись в RA делителя в прямом коде


Восста­новление остатка



Суммирование RA и RB (промежуточного остатка)








Сдвиг остатка на 1 разряд влево, занесение очередного разряда делимого


Запись в RA делителя в обратном коде







Суммирование RA и RB (промежуточного остатка) с прибавлением 1













Восстановление остатка

“0”

<0”

Запись 1 в очередной разряд частного

Запись 0 в очередной разряд частного

>0”

Уменьшение содержимого счетчика на 1

=0”

Запись в RA делителя в прямом коде

Суммирование RA и RB (промежуточного остатка)

Рис. 3.2. Блок-схема выполнения операции деления с восстановлением остатка



1   2   3   4   5   6   7   8   9   10   11

Похожие:

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conМосковский авиационный институт (государственный технический университет)
Перечень подлежащих разработке в дипломном проекте вопросов или краткое содержание дипломной работы
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conА. В. Репин Уфимский государственный авиационный технический университет, Уфа
Уфимский государственный авиационный технический университет в лице информационно-технического центра "Компьютеры и телекоммуникации"...
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conУчебно-методическое пособие г. Ахтубинск 2008 б- удк 621. 396 001. 24 (075) московский авиационный институт (государственный технический университет) Быков А.
Целью работ является освоение методов моделирования, понятие о моделировании динамических звеньев и сигналов
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conРоссийской федерации
Тамбовский государственный технический университет, Томский государственный университет, Тульский государственный университет, Тюменский...
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conМосковский авиационный институт (национальный исследовательский университет)
Тема ( …ч, срс … ч)
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conМосковский государственный институт международных отношений (университет)
Ю. В. Дубинин Чрезвычайный и Полномочный Посол Российской Федерации, к и н., профессор Кафедры дипломатии
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conРоссийской Федерации Саратовский государственный технический университет Технологический институт (филиал) сгту кафедра Материаловедение
Определение геометрических параметров шарнирного четырехзвенника. Построение плана положений механизма
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conНастоящее Положение по организации и проведению лекций (далее Положение) разработано в соответствии с Постановлением Правительства Российской Федерации от
Гоу впо «Южно-Российский государственный технический университет (Новочеркасский политехнический институт)»
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conМосковский физико-технический институт (государственный университет) утверждаю
Постановка задач оптимизации. Локальный и глобальный экстремумы. Классификация экстремальных задач. Примеры
Российской Федерации Московский Авиационный Институт (государственный технический университет) Г. А. Звонарева, А. В. Корнеенкова iconМосковский энергетический институт (технический университет)

Разместите кнопку на своём сайте:
Библиотека


База данных защищена авторским правом ©lib2.znate.ru 2012
обратиться к администрации
Библиотека
Главная страница